Warning Signs You Need Water Heater Leak Water Removal

Ignoring the warning signs of a water heater leak can lead to costly repairs and even health hazards. Keep an eye out for these common signs:

Musty Odors That Won’t Go Away

Strong, unpleasant odors in your home or business could show a water heater leak. Don’t ignore these odors, they can be a sign of mold and mildew growth.

Water Stains on Ceilings or Walls

Visible water stains on your ceilings or walls can be a sign of a water heater leak. These stains can be difficult to remove and may need professional attention.

Warped or Buckled Flooring

Warped or buckled flooring can be a sign of water damage from a leaky water heater. This damage can be costly to repair and may need replacement of the affected flooring.

Unusual Noises from the Water Heater

Unusual noises from your water heater, such as clunking or gurgling sounds, can show a problem with the unit. Don’t ignore these noises, they can be a sign of a leak or other issue.

Water Leaks Under the Water Heater

Visible water leaks under the water heater can be a sign of a serious problem. Don’t try to fix this issue yourself, call a professional for help.

Increased Water Bills

Increased water bills can be a sign of a water heater leak. If your bills are higher than usual, it may be worth investigating the issue further.

Common Questions About Water Heater Leak Water Removal

Q: How long will it take to dry my property?

A: The drying process typically takes 3-5 days, depending on the severity of the damage and the size of the affected area. Our team will work with you to establish a realistic timeline and provide regular updates on the progress of the job.

Q: Will I need to replace my water heater?

A: In some cases, yes, if the leak is severe or the water heater is old or damaged, it may be necessary to replace the unit. Our team will assess the situation and provide recommendations for the best course of action.
